The Tigers clawed their way back into the match eight minutes after the break when Ashford profited from a Marshall cut-out ball to score out wide. Marshall missed the conversion to leave the Tigers trailing 24-16.

Manly restored its advantage a few moments later when Lyon leapt highest to mark a Foran crossfield kick and plant the ball next to the posts for his second try of the afternoon. Lyon converted his own try to push Manly to a 30-16 lead.

The Tigers refused to give-in and they grabbed their fourth try of the afternoon when Marshall worked a double man play to put Tuqiri away down the left flank. The big winger smashed his way through the tackle of Farrar before twisting and planting the ball for a try in the corner before the cover defence was able to put him into touch. Marshall missed the conversion from the sideline to leave the score 30-20 midway through the second half.

Manly looked to have killed off the match in the 66th minute when substitute prop Brent Kite popped a great pass for Farrar to hit the ball at pace and dive over under the posts. Lyon put the ball over the black dot to put Manly 36-20 in front.

Lyon extended Manly’s lead to 38-20 with a penalty from right in front eight minutes from full-time to seal a strong win at the right end of the season.
